Halo Solutions’ multi-award-winning incident and risk management platform – the Halo System – has been integrated at ExCeL London as part of a new partnership designed to further enhance safety and security at the venue.
The new system, already used at 1,800 events across the UK including sporting events, arenas and conferences, will help to strengthen the venue’s existing high-level operations and event management. This includes providing live-action updates on all incidents, tasks and venue checks, and seamlessly linking ExCeL’s in-house teams and controllers.

Halo’s ground-breaking platform for risk management continues to expand in the public safety industry, with more than 30 million people overseen at events using the system last year. The recently launched ‘Halo v5’ offers additional features and integrations, including new modules in accreditation, sustainability, crowd management and live video feed and drone integrations.
